Peters & Peters acted for the CEO and managing director of one of the largest chemical producers in the world following a request for their extradition for offences of fraud, tax evasion of more than £5 million and money laundering.
We analysed the tax offences which were essentially allegations of transfer pricing to allow sale at an undervalue to a connected party. We demonstrated that these allegations were without merit by showing that the products were sold at market price and were not sold to a connected company.
These allegations were all made for political reasons in an attempt to secure the hostile takeover of the company and we provided compelling expert evidence to prove this and that there was no prospect of a fair trial for our clients if extradited.
In 2009 the extradition proceedings were stopped on the basis that the prosecution was politically motivated and that there was no prospect of a fair trial if extradition took place.
